The 10 finalists for 2012 Double Mitsubishi Draw have been drawn at Sea Rescue head office. Congratulations to the finalists and a huge thank you to all our supporters!The finalists are are:Mr B Van Rensburg, Hyper By The Sea, Mr P Groenenstein, Gordon’s Bay, Mr R Van Der Walt, Ashwood, Miss L Waterkeyn, Greenpoint, Mrs E Rainer, Cowie’s Hill, Mr L Wacher, Knysna, Mr G Burger, Wellington, Mr P Verhoef, Atlasville, Mr V Van Zyl, Westville and Mr J Fourie from Tyger Valley.Mr. Leighton Greene of Durban has won the annual R100 000 cash prize in the NSRI Debit Order Competition.The final draw is on Tuesday 18th December, at 16h00 at the Mitsubishi Show Room in Paarden Eiland, Cape Town. The winner will be driving away in a PAJERO 3.2 Diesel 4x4 LWB and the ASX 2.0L (classic) – together valued at over R800 000. The 2nd prize winner will walk away with a Gemini Waverider 470, rigid inflatable boat plus trailer, and the 3rd prize winner will walk off with a trip for 2 to the 2013 Spanish GrandPrix.
